It was a overcast rainy day so I decided to bake a Pear upside-down cake and cook the pork roast that I brined yesterday.
On the Egg @ 350* for 1 hr.
Rotated 180* @ :30 min.
After a 30-min. rest.
The pork roast with just black pepper for seasoning.
Seared on both sides and put on a raised grid for 55-min @ 350* and rested for 10-min.
Served with mashed red potatoes and romaine salad.
And desert pear upside-down cake. The pork was very moist and delicious the upside down cake was delicious and well do both soon.
